How Roulette Loyalty Programs Work

Roulette loyalty programs work by awarding players points or other rewards based on their wagers and gameplay. The more you play, the more you can earn in rewards. These rewards can range from free spins and bonus cash to exclusive promotions and VIP perks. House Edge in Roulette Loyalty Program Real Money Play

The house edge in roulette loyalty program real money play varies depending on the type of bet you place. Overall, the house edge for European roulette is 2.7%, while the house edge for American roulette is 5.26%. Payouts in Roulette Loyalty Program Real Money Play

Roulette payouts vary depending on the type of bet you place. For example, a straight bet on a single number pays out at 35:1, while a bet on red or black pays out at 1:1. By understanding the odds and payouts of different bets, you can make more informed decisions when playing roulette in a loyalty program.
